news 2026/6/21 15:44:21

RIGHTMENUMGR原型:1小时打造个性化菜单管理器

作者头像

张小明

前端开发工程师

1.2k 24
文章封面图
RIGHTMENUMGR原型:1小时打造个性化菜单管理器

快速体验

  1. 打开 InsCode(快马)平台 https://www.inscode.net
  2. 输入框内输入如下内容:
快速开发一个RIGHTMENUMGR最小可行产品(MVP),核心功能包括:1. 基本菜单项列表展示 2. 开关切换功能 3. 简单的添加自定义命令 4. 基础UI界面。使用Electron实现跨平台支持,代码结构清晰便于后续扩展。要求在1小时内完成可运行的原型开发。
  1. 点击'项目生成'按钮,等待项目生成完整后预览效果

作为一个经常需要验证产品想法的开发者,我最近尝试用InsCode(快马)平台快速搭建了一个名为RIGHTMENUMGR的菜单管理器原型。整个过程比想象中顺利,特别适合需要快速验证概念的创业者或独立开发者。下面分享我的实践过程:

  1. 明确核心需求这个工具的核心是帮助用户管理常用菜单项,所以MVP需要实现四个基本功能:展示菜单列表、支持开关切换、允许添加自定义命令、提供简单直观的界面。Electron框架能保证跨平台使用,这对后期推广很重要。

  2. 搭建基础框架在平台上新建Electron项目后,先创建主进程和渲染进程的基本结构。主进程负责窗口管理和IPC通信,渲染进程用HTML+CSS构建界面骨架。这里惊喜地发现平台已经预置了Electron基础配置,省去了webpack等环境搭建时间。

  3. 实现菜单列表展示用数组存储初始菜单项数据,通过动态生成DOM元素的方式渲染列表。每项包含图标、名称、状态开关三个部分。这里遇到一个小坑:Electron的进程间通信需要特别注意数据序列化问题,后来改用JSON传递对象就解决了。

  4. 添加交互功能为每个菜单项绑定点击事件,点击开关时通过IPC通知主进程更新状态。自定义命令功能稍微复杂些,需要增加一个模态框接收用户输入,然后将新命令追加到列表并持久化存储。平台提供的实时预览功能让调试过程非常高效。

  5. 界面优化技巧虽然只是原型,但良好的UI能提升演示效果。使用Flex布局确保响应式设计,添加简单的过渡动画增强交互感。平台内置的浏览器开发者工具可以随时检查元素样式,比本地开发还方便。

整个开发过程中,最耗时的其实是功能逻辑的构思,实际编码反而很快。平台的一键运行功能让测试变得极其简单,不需要操心环境变量或依赖问题。最终成品虽然简单,但完整演示了核心价值主张:让用户能快速启用/禁用各类菜单项,并添加自己的常用命令。

对于想快速验证产品想法的人来说,这种开发方式有几个显著优势: - 即时反馈:每次修改都能秒看效果 - 零配置:专注业务逻辑而非环境搭建 - 可分享:生成的可运行原型方便演示 - 低成本:无需购买服务器或域名

这次体验让我意识到,InsCode(快马)平台特别适合做这种快速原型开发。从空白项目到可演示的MVP,我只用了不到一小时,而且整个过程就像在本地开发一样流畅。如果你也有个产品想法需要快速验证,不妨试试这种开发方式,可能会节省大量前期投入成本。

快速体验

  1. 打开 InsCode(快马)平台 https://www.inscode.net
  2. 输入框内输入如下内容:
快速开发一个RIGHTMENUMGR最小可行产品(MVP),核心功能包括:1. 基本菜单项列表展示 2. 开关切换功能 3. 简单的添加自定义命令 4. 基础UI界面。使用Electron实现跨平台支持,代码结构清晰便于后续扩展。要求在1小时内完成可运行的原型开发。
  1. 点击'项目生成'按钮,等待项目生成完整后预览效果
版权声明: 本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若内容造成侵权/违法违规/事实不符,请联系邮箱:809451989@qq.com进行投诉反馈,一经查实,立即删除!
网站建设 2026/6/17 18:31:43

VibeVoice-WEB-UI是否支持语音生成任务提醒?待办事项

VibeVoice-WEB-UI:当TTS不再只是“朗读”,而是“演绎” 在播客制作人熬夜剪辑音频、有声书团队反复校对角色语气的今天,我们是否还能想象一种可能——只需输入一段结构化文本,系统就能自动理解谁该说什么、何时停顿、以何种情绪表…

作者头像 李华
网站建设 2026/6/15 14:32:43

零基础教程:用AI制作你的第一个Chrome插件

快速体验 打开 InsCode(快马)平台 https://www.inscode.net输入框内输入如下内容: 生成一个最简单的Chrome插件入门示例:当用户点击插件图标时,弹出窗口显示当前网页标题和URL。包含完整的manifest.json配置,使用最基础的browse…

作者头像 李华
网站建设 2026/6/17 6:16:25

AI如何帮你一键搞定CP2102驱动开发

快速体验 打开 InsCode(快马)平台 https://www.inscode.net输入框内输入如下内容: 请生成一个完整的CP2102 USB转串口驱动程序代码,要求包含以下功能:1.自动检测设备插入/拔出事件 2.实现波特率配置功能(支持9600-115200) 3.数据收发缓冲区…

作者头像 李华
网站建设 2026/6/18 11:16:43

快速验证:用AI生成VCRUNTIME140.DLL修复工具原型

快速体验 打开 InsCode(快马)平台 https://www.inscode.net输入框内输入如下内容: 快速开发一个VCRUNTIME140.DLL修复工具最小可行产品(MVP),核心功能:1.基本系统扫描;2.自动下载正确版本的DLL文件;3.简单注册表修复…

作者头像 李华
网站建设 2026/6/17 1:35:47

零基础教程:如何在自己的电脑上部署AI模型

快速体验 打开 InsCode(快马)平台 https://www.inscode.net输入框内输入如下内容: 开发一个新手友好的本地AI部署向导工具,功能:1. 自动检测系统环境并推荐合适的AI模型;2. 提供图形化的一键部署流程;3. 包含5个入门…

作者头像 李华
网站建设 2026/6/21 3:28:21

零基础入门:10分钟学会使用MONACO EDITOR

快速体验 打开 InsCode(快马)平台 https://www.inscode.net输入框内输入如下内容: 制作一个交互式MONACO EDITOR教程页面。左侧是分步指导,右侧是实时编辑器。每步教程都有对应的代码示例,用户可以直接在编辑器中修改和运行。从最简单的Hel…

作者头像 李华